I like it, other than the fact that the price keeps going up, but that goes for all of them I suppose. I was going to upgrade to the genie, but the service tech came out and said he was going to have to go through the side of the house since I have 12 ft. ceilings. I decided to keep the equipment I have for now. He said with the primary genie box you can't pick it up and take it with you tailgating or camping like you can with the older equipment. Not sure if that is true, but might be something to consider. You could get one regular HD box in one room and do the genies in the others.

Also, weather isn't too much of an issue. If the signal goes out, I can generally pick up the standard definition channel signal about 99% of the time, unless it is a major storm.

The Genie is the best TV receiver ever made. They have Genie minis and wireless Genie minis for your auxillary TVs. Middle of the pack service, but like others say, they aren't going to lose you for $20-$30 a month.

They also give you RF remotes for no cost up front so you can hide your components without having one of those $250+ remotes, if thats important to you.
